Description

Open Access Management (OpenAM) is an access management solution. Prior to 16.1.1, certain federation endpoints in a non-default clustered configuration inconsistently encode user-supplied parameters rendered into HTML in the SAML2 cluster cookie-hash redirect path. An unauthenticated attacker can induce a user to follow a crafted request and execute script in the OpenAM origin. This issue is fixed in version 16.1.1.

CWE ID Description
CWE-79 The product does not neutralize or incorrectly neutralizes user-controllable input before it is placed in output that is used as a web page that is served to other users.

Executive Summary

CVE-2026-44793 is a reflected Cross-Site Scripting (XSS) vulnerability in OpenAM, a federated identity management solution. It occurs in certain federation endpoints that fail to properly encode user-supplied parameters in HTML responses during pre-authentication. This flaw is exploitable in non-default clustered configurations, allowing attackers to execute malicious scripts in the OpenAM origin without authentication.

Impact Analysis

An attacker could trick a user into following a crafted link, leading to script execution in the OpenAM origin. This may result in session hijacking, theft of sensitive data, or unauthorized actions performed on behalf of the user. The impact depends on the user's privileges and the data accessible through OpenAM.

Mitigation Strategies

Upgrade OpenAM to version 16.1.1 or later immediately. If upgrading is not possible, disable affected federation endpoints or apply input validation for user-supplied parameters like the STATE parameter in SAML2 requests.
